В моей системе используется UEFI, и я хочу установить Windows 7 и 8 на большой диск, отформатированный для GPT (я также хочу установить несколько других операционных систем, и мне нужно больше 7 разделов).
После установки Windows 7 при попытке установить Windows 8 я не могу выбрать раздел для установки и получаю сообщение «Невозможно установить Windows на этот диск. Выбранный диск имеет стиль раздела GPT».
Насколько я понимаю, я могу установить одну систему Windows на каждый диск, потому что Windows нужно создать загрузочный раздел EFI (и MSR, что бы это ни было). Вторая установка откажется устанавливаться, если уже есть загрузочный раздел EFI.
Есть ли способ обойти это, кроме как отключить UEFI и использовать MBR для диска?
решение1
Насколько я понимаю, я могу установить одну систему Windows на каждый диск, потому что Windows нужно создать загрузочный раздел EFI (и MSR, что бы это ни было). Вторая установка откажется устанавливаться, если уже есть загрузочный раздел EFI.
Это не должно быть причиной. Вполне нормально совместно использовать один системный раздел EFI между несколькими операционными системами.
Хотя я никогда не пробовал несколько версий Windows одновременно – естьмогмогут возникнуть некоторые проблемы из-за того, что обе версии хранят загрузчик по одному и тому же \EFI\Microsoft
пути, но загрузчики Win7 и Win8 должны быть совместимы.
Я получаю сообщение «Невозможно установить Windows на этот диск. Выбранный диск имеет стиль раздела GPT».
AFAIK, сообщение не имеет ничего общего с тем, какие у вас разделы. Оно появляется именно из-за самого GPT – то есть,вы загрузили установочный CD в режиме BIOS, а Windows отказывается смешивать BIOS с GPT (а также UEFI с MBR) для своего системного диска.
(Обратите внимание, чтонекоторые сообщения на форумеутверждают, что установочный компакт-диск Windows 7не мочьзагрузка в режиме UEFI, но я был бы удивлен, если бы это действительно было правдой...)
Мне нужно больше 7 разделов
Хотя MBR ограничен 4 основными разделами, насколько мне известно, ограничений на их количество нет.логичныйразделы, которые можно разместить внутри расширенного...
решение2
То, что вы хотите сделать, возможно; я видел посты людей, которые это сделали. Хотя сам я этого не делал.
Как говорит grawity, ваше сообщение об ошибке является результатом вашей первой установки в режиме EFI/UEFI и вашей (случайно/по ошибке) загрузки второй установки в режиме BIOS/CSM/legacy. Вы должны изучить процедуру, чтобы заставить вашу систему загрузить установочный носитель в любом желаемом вами режиме. Этообычноможно получить, нажав функциональную клавишу (которая меняется) при запуске системы, чтобы попасть во встроенный менеджер загрузки компьютера. Если повезет, вы увидите два варианта для вашего загрузочного носителя, один из которых включает строку "UEFI", а другой - нет. Выберите вариант "UEFI", чтобы загрузиться в этом режиме, а другой - чтобы загрузиться в режиме BIOS/CSM/legacy. Однако эта процедура не всегда работает - естьнетстандартизация пользовательских интерфейсов EFI/UEFI, поэтому некоторые реализации делают вещи не так, как другие, а некоторые не предлагают критически важную функциональность, как эта. Это то, с чего вам следует начать поиск. В худшем случае вам, возможно, придется прыгнуть через обручи, чтобы создать загрузочный носитель, который поддерживает нужный вам режим загрузки, но не тот, который вы не хотите использовать.
Также есть вопрос о том,Системный раздел EFI (ESP)и тот факт, что обе версии Windows попытаются разместить свой собственный загрузчик на EFI\Microsoft\Boot\bootmgfw.efi
ESP. Насколько я понимаю, этодолженработают нормально, и менеджер загрузки Windows предоставит вам выбор версии Windows для загрузки. (Конечно, при условии, что вы случайно не перезапишете свою первую установку, когда будете делать вторую.) Однако, если вы предпочитаете использовать что-то другое для выбора вашей ОС, или если вы устанавливаете третью ОС и хотите иметь единое меню для управления загрузкой ОС, вам может быть лучше создать два ESP, чтобы каждая версия Windows имела свой собственный. Это может потребовать временного изменения кодов типов ESP, чтобы заставить каждый установщик использовать тот, который вы хотите. В целом, с двумя версиями Windows и ничем другим, вам, вероятно, лучше использовать один ESP и позволить загрузчику Windows представить свое собственное меню.
решение3
У меня возникли проблемы при первой установке Windows 7 на диск GPT в UEFI. Я думаю, проблема была в настройках BIOS... когда я вошел и убедился, что настройка для запуска Windows установлена в режиме EFI, а основное загрузочное устройство — в версии UEFI моего проигрывателя дисков, все стало нормально. (если вы загружаетесь с USB, эта настройка не применяется, но вам также нужно настроить Windows на запуск в режиме EFI в BIOS)
но теперь у меня установлены Windows 7 и 10, на GPT-диске, в режиме UEFI... так что это "возможно". Вы разберетесь.
решение4
Windows 7 ПОДДЕРЖИВАЕТ загрузку GPT.
Это возможно, если вы используете обе версии 64 бит.
Но быстрая загрузка приведет к тому, что диск будет (программно) загрязнен и Windows 7 заставит выполнить chkdsk. Вам нужно отключить ее.
Вероятно, вы получаете это сообщение, поскольку используете 32-битную версию.